About

Guang Feng is a scholar working on Renewable Energy, Sustainability and the Environment, Materials Chemistry and Electrical and Electronic Engineering. According to data from OpenAlex, Guang Feng has authored 35 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Renewable Energy, Sustainability and the Environment, 12 papers in Materials Chemistry and 11 papers in Electrical and Electronic Engineering. Recurrent topics in Guang Feng’s work include Electrocatalysts for Energy Conversion (11 papers), Advanced Photocatalysis Techniques (8 papers) and Catalytic Processes in Materials Science (6 papers). Guang Feng is often cited by papers focused on Electrocatalysts for Energy Conversion (11 papers), Advanced Photocatalysis Techniques (8 papers) and Catalytic Processes in Materials Science (6 papers). Guang Feng collaborates with scholars based in China, United Kingdom and Canada. Guang Feng's co-authors include Dingguo Xia, Xiaoming Sun, Yun Kuang, Song Jin, Fanghua Ning, Pengsong Li, Huaifang Shang, Yongmin Bi, Yaping Li and Wangsheng Chu and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and Advanced Materials.
